### Crossword generator regen step

When reviewing changes to the Gridwright generator, regenerate the fixture puzzles before approving. Run `gridwright regen --suite smoke` from the repo root; it pulls word lists from the internal Lexhaven dictionary service and writes fixtures to `testdata/`. Diffs larger than 200 lines usually mean a scoring change. The Lexhaven service key for local runs is below.

service key, fawip-bajef: kto11_Qt5wZK9vdNC

Security reviewer: before the signing key touches the Glyphcart release, verify every vendored third-party font against the pinned manifest. Confirm hashes match, license files are present and unmodified, and no font contains embedded executable tables beyond the approved list. Record each verification in the ceremony ledger with your initials and a second witness. Once all fonts pass, the sealed signing token may be unlocked with the recovery passphrase recorded below.

strongbox words: aldax-istox-sorion-isteth-gilion-tamius-norok-aldax-fraox-wenius

INTERNAL MEMO — Harwick Depot Opening

The first uniform consignment for the new Grelston Road depot ships Thursday via Bramblehart Couriers. Each carton is labelled by size band; please verify counts against the packing slip before signing, and report any shortfall to Depot Services within 24 hours. The courier hand-over instruction for this consignment is as follows.

handover note for yagef-bagep: the drudor pelius courier leaves the kasdor zorvan norir ledger at gate 8016 under passcode 755406

**Ticket: Marrowgate Library catalogue import stalls at 62%**

Priority: high. The nightly MARC import into Shelfwright consistently halts partway through the periodicals batch, leaving the catalogue in a mixed state — older records visible, newer ones missing. Restarting the job resumes but duplicates roughly 300 entries, so please do not retry blindly. Suspected cause is a malformed subfield in one source record; the parser swallows the error and deadlocks on the next read. The failing run's trace is below.

build token for bajog-yaduf: htk9_39788324c